A successful Interim Manager can add value in a number of ways;
- to reverse a deterioration in KPI's
- as a 'fresh pair of eyes' to identify improvements to processes and procedures
- where there is insufficient time and resource internally to get the best from debt collection agencies and other third party suppliers
- as a mentor to younger managers who have not experienced a recession or downturn
- whilst recruiting to fill a permanent position
- as cover for maternity leave
- during a freeze on permanent staff recruitment
